Background and Detail
The rise of cyber warfare has transformed the landscape of national security. In recent years, various state-sponsored groups have engaged in cyber operations that threaten the integrity of critical infrastructure. Iranian hackers, in particular, have been implicated in several high-profile cyberattacks targeting various sectors, including finance, healthcare, and energy. Notable incidents include the 2012 cyberattack on Saudi Aramco, which resulted in the destruction of thousands of computers, and the 2016 attack on the US Democratic National Committee, which highlighted the capabilities of Iranian cyber operatives.
The operational technology systems that these hackers are targeting are often less secure than traditional IT systems. Many utilities still rely on legacy systems that may not be equipped to handle modern cybersecurity threats. This makes them particularly vulnerable to sophisticated attacks that can disrupt operations or even cause physical damage. For example, the Stuxnet worm, which targeted Iran’s nuclear facilities, demonstrated how cyberattacks can have real-world consequences by causing physical destruction.
